To achieve a method that is capable of more accurately controlling a preload applied to rolling bodies. An amount of decrease ΔC in an axial clearance of a hub unit bearing 1 is found based on an amount of expansion ΔD of an inner ring, which is the difference between the outer-diameter dimension D of the inner ring 13 after the inner ring 13 is externally fitted with a tubular fitting portion 17 of a hub spindle 14 and after formation of a swaged portion 19, and an outer-diameter dimension Do of the inner ring 13 before the inner ring 13 is externally fitted with the tubular fitting portion 17.
